trigger zone

a low-threshold region for eliciting a response. In a neuron, the trigger zone for evoking an action potential is the axon hillock, where postsynaptic potentials summate. In the brain, stimulation of the chemoreceptor trigger zone in the medulla oblongata provokes vomiting.
